#610510 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#610510 is composed of 38% red, 2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 94.8% magenta, 83.5%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 352.8 degrees, a saturation of 90.2% and a lightness of 20%. #610510 color hex could be obtained by blending #c20a20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

Shades and Tints of #610510
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040001 is the darkest color, while #fef0f2 is the lightest one.
